Easter Cakepops

I love love love Bakerella. So I decided that I wanted to make her Easter cakepops. (I did a test run of smiley faces the week before. For an April Fools Day treat for Shane and I to take to work...good thing I did this because they didn't turn out too well. I highly reccomend getting the brand of edible markers that Bakerella uses as well as some good candy coating. Wilton just didn't do it for me. Love their cake decorating items, not so much the candy making ones)


First Step, cut up the cake and remove the pieces


Break it up into chunks


Then crumble, crumble, crumble


Add in most of the can of frosting

Mix it together...this will get messy

Yes, dear me, I did two flavors of cake

Here is the strawberry cake crumbled

Added frosting...

Mixed up!

I rolled the chocolate cake into balls for the chicks and the strawberry into pointy ball shapes for the bunnies...they were pretty tricky to make attractively even.
